Title:
BEARING STRUCTURE OF SPIRAL TYPE TRANSPORT DEVICE

Abstract:

To provide a bearing structure of a spiral type transport device capable of securing retention of a liner.

A bearing structure of a spiral type transport device includes: two spiral shafts 40, the shaft centers of which intersect each other; a connection metal 100 which rotatably supports the spiral shafts 40 with gears provided on the spiral shafts, respectively, meshing with each other, and is divided into two parts on a plane passing the shafts centers of two spiral shafts 40 and formed by casting; an abrasion preventive liner 140 which is formed in a curve along a part located outside in the radial direction of the spiral shaft 40 in the inner peripheral surface 108 of the connection metal 100, mounted to the part, and made of material having a higher strength than the material for forming the connection metal 100; a fit part 141 formed on the abrasion preventive liner 140 and projected outwardly from the abrasion preventive line 140; and a liner mounting groove 111 formed on the inner peripheral surface 108 of the connection metal 100, which the fit part 141 enters in mounting the abrasion preventive liner 140 to the inner peripheral surface 108.
